Photochemical permutation of meta-substituted phenols
Abstract Phenols and their derivatives are highly relevant motifs in pharmaceuticals, natural products, and other functional materials. Conventional strategies for phenol synthesis rely on classical aromatic functionalization, which is often dictated by electronic and steric factors. Herein, we repo...
